How to Calculate the Area of a Parallelogram

A parallelogram is a quadrilateral with two pairs of parallel sides. To find its area, multiply the base by the perpendicular height. Unlike a rectangle, the height is not the same as the side length — it is the perpendicular distance between the base and the opposite side. If you also know the side length, you can calculate the perimeter as P = 2(base + side).

Parallelogram Area Formula

A = base × height

Perimeter = 2 × (base + side)

Example

Find the area of a parallelogram with base 10 and height 6:

A = base × height

A = 10 × 6

A = 60 square units

Frequently Asked Questions

What is the difference between a parallelogram and a rectangle?

A rectangle is a special parallelogram where all angles are 90°. In a general parallelogram, opposite angles are equal but not necessarily 90°. The area formula is the same: base × height.

Why is the height different from the side?

The height is the perpendicular distance between the base and the opposite side. In a slanted parallelogram, the side is longer than the height because it is at an angle. Only in a rectangle are the side and height equal.

Can I find the area using diagonals?

Yes, if you know both diagonals (d₁, d₂) and the angle θ between them: A = ½ × d₁ × d₂ × sin(θ). This is useful when the height is not directly measurable.

Is a rhombus a parallelogram?

Yes. A rhombus is a special parallelogram where all four sides are equal. Its area can be calculated as base × height or using its diagonals: A = ½ × d₁ × d₂.
